Dinner is the anchor. Unlike Western families who may eat in shifts, the Indian family tries to eat together—or at least sit together while others eat.
The Daily Story: The Phone Call At 9:00 PM, the phone rings. It is the uncle in America. The whole family crowds around the single phone (or the WhatsApp video call). The grandparents who cannot speak English just stare at the screen and say, "You have become thin." The cousin in New York shows off the snow. The Indian family, though separated by oceans, shrinks the distance through ritualistic phone calls.
The Final Ritual: Before bed, the mother goes to the pooja room (prayer room). She lights a lamp. The children rush in for five seconds to touch the feet of the idols and their parents. The father turns off the gas cylinder valve. The maid locks the back gate.
And then, silence. Until the pressure cooker starts hissing at 6:00 AM again.

If you have ever stood outside a Indian home at 6:00 AM, you would not hear silence. You would hear a pressure cooker hissing, the clang of a steel tiffin box being packed, a radio humming a bhajan, and a mother yelling, “Beta, have you kept your socks?”
To understand India, you must understand its family. It is not merely a unit; it is a self-contained ecosystem. In an era where "nuclear" is becoming the norm globally, the Indian family often remains a beautiful, messy, sprawling joint or multi-generational setup. The day begins early, often before the sun hits the dusty street. In the kitchen, the matriarch (usually Grandma or Mom) is already awake. The smell of filter coffee or chai brews alongside the sound of a steel kadhai (wok).
The Daily Story: The Tiffin Shuffle At 7:00 AM, chaos reigns. Three different lunch boxes are being packed simultaneously. Dad needs low-carb rotis. The teenage daughter is on a diet of fruits. The younger son demands paneer (cottage cheese) because his friend got it yesterday. There is no anger in this chaos; only negotiation. Meanwhile, Grandpa is doing his yoga on the terrace, and the family dog is strategically positioned under the dining table, waiting for a dropped piece of paratha.
Lifestyle fact: The Indian "Tiffin" is not just food. It is a love letter packed in a steel container. No matter how old you get, your mother’s tiffin is the standard against which all restaurant food is judged.
